There is a TikTok challenge called "Smack a Teacher." In it, you record yourself smacking a teacher and upload it to TikTok. That's it. That's the challenge. In 2011's The Muppets, "Punch a Teacher" was a sarcastic example of an offensive show. In real life or "IRL," kids are actually doing it for likes and shares. Police believe the "Smack a Teacher" challenge might be to blame for students assaulting a disabled teacher in Louisiana. But they aren't sure. It's either that, or the students are just scumbags.
